Critical water upgrade works progressing in the Athlone area
Information below is relevant until further updates are provided here or on our Supply and Service Updates section
Uisce Éireann is making steady progress on the Athlone Water Network Upgrade project which will facilitate future development in the town, support social and economic growth, and improve the capacity and performance of Athlone’s water network.
To facilitate the connection of newly installed water mains, there will be a planned outage next Monday night. Customers in Montree, Athlone Town, Cornamagh, Ballymahon Road and the surrounding areas may experience some disruption to their supply on Monday, 26 January from 7pm to Tuesday, 27 January at 7am.
Uisce Éireann’s Padraig Hanly said: “We understand the inconvenience caused by an interruption to supply overnight. Every effort will be made to limit the impact of these essential works, and we would like to thank the community in advance for their patience and co-operation.”
As the water supply returns, there may be some increased instances of discoloured water in the short-term. For helpful tips on what to do following an outage, visit our Issues during or after an outage page.
